Close to perfect setting in Kirstenbosch botanical gardens. Warm and welcoming African ambiance with friendly waiters. Went with a party of 7 for a late afternoon lunch and service was quick and efficient.
Food was excellent. I had the Chicken Date Tagine with Moroccan rice. This was well presented and delicious with a fusion of tastes and spices. Chicken was on the bone but well cooked and flaked away easily.
My wife had the Kraal Grill 300g Sirloin with potato wedges that she found tasty and cooked exactly as requested.
Everyone else was completely satisfied and enjoyed their meals.
All in all a thoroughly enjoyable experience and certainly a restaurant that I can recommend.

This branch is inside kirstenbosch botanical gardens and it is the best branch from my point of view. It offers a unique African experience with decor, music and of course the food. What I loved about this place was the lunch open buffet. It is 26 meters long and has 45 different dishes as the chef has informed us. The buffet gave me the freedom to try many African dishes which I enjoyed immensely.
